Overview of Engine Coolant Thermostats

Engine coolant thermostats are simple yet effective devices that regulate the flow of coolant to the engine. They are typically located between the engine and the radiator and work by opening and closing in response to the temperature of the engine. When the engine is cold, the thermostat remains closed, allowing it to warm up quickly. Once the engine reaches the optimum temperature, the thermostat opens, allowing the coolant to circulate and maintain a stable operating temperature.

Principles Behind Engine Coolant Thermostats

The main principle behind engine coolant thermostats is temperature regulation. By controlling the flow of coolant, the thermostat helps to ensure that the engine operates at the ideal temperature for performance and efficiency. Operating at the correct temperature not only improves fuel efficiency but also reduces wear and tear on the engine components, ultimately extending the life of the vehicle.

Usage Tips

To ensure the optimal performance of your engine coolant thermostat, it is essential to follow a few usage tips:

  • Regularly check and maintain the coolant levels in your vehicle.
  • Inspect the thermostat for any signs of wear or damage and replace it if necessary.
  • Ensure that the thermostat is compatible with your vehicle’s make and model for proper functionality.
  • Seek professional help if you notice any irregularities in your vehicle’s cooling system.
